Subject: [PATCH] xfs:xfs_dir2_node.c: pointer use before check for null

Reorder of assert and args pointer dereference.

Found by Linux Driver Verification project (linuxtesting.org) -
PVS-Studio analyzer.

Signed-off-by: Denis Efremov <yefremov.denis@...il.com>
---
 fs/xfs/xfs_dir2_node.c | 2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/fs/xfs/xfs_dir2_node.c b/fs/xfs/xfs_dir2_node.c
index 4c3dba7..0ba7382 100644
--- a/fs/xfs/xfs_dir2_node.c
+++ b/fs/xfs/xfs_dir2_node.c
@@ -1365,8 +1365,8 @@ xfs_dir2_leafn_split(
 	 * Allocate space for a new leaf node.
 	 */
 	args = state->args;
-	mp = args->dp->i_mount;
 	ASSERT(args != NULL);
+	mp = args->dp->i_mount;
 	ASSERT(oldblk->magic == XFS_DIR2_LEAFN_MAGIC);
 	error = xfs_da_grow_inode(args, &blkno);
 	if (error) {
